Wins National and State Awards

rpmlogo

At its annual conference in March, 2008, Parenting Publications of America (PPA) gave Richmond Parents Monthly six awards, including a first-place award for best writing overall.
 
PPA is a national trade association of more than 120 local parenting publications. Its annual contest recognizes excellence in writing and design. This year, PPA received 1,249 entries in three size divisions. Judging was coordinated by Professor Daryl Moen of the University of Missouri School of Journalism.
 
The full listing of Richmond Parents Monthly’s awards for work published in 2007 is below, with judges’ comments.
 
Gold
Overall Writing

“The stories clearly have a guiding hand that ensures they stay on point while offering valuable local resources and interesting, compelling interviews. Whether addressing how friendships impact racism or heading back to school after divorce, the writing is clear and focused. Enjoyable to read.
 
Gold
Front Cover/Newsprint: Original Illustration

Ryan Hooley, illustrator; Denine D’Angelo, art director
“A nice cover that uses a play on words to partner with the drawing. The artist used warm colors for the family scene, and the designer integrated the nameplate into the atmosphere.”
 
Silver
Publisher’s/Editor’s Notes
Angela Lehman-Rios, editor

“The writer takes big issues, such as keeping kids in touch with nature and diversity and shows why they are important to the publication's local readers.”

Silver
Personal Essay

“Oh friend of mine,” Ania Swanson, author
“This essay’s construction draws readers into it. At times, ‘Oh friend of mine,’ resonates like a song with a strong chorus. Yet beneath the beautiful construction lies important points about disabled children and the parents who love them.”

Bronze
Interview

“The True Story of Boys Reading,” Lisa Thalhimer, writer

“Any parent of boys will be thrilled to find such an insightful interview that clearly illustrates how and why boys read. A fun and informative read.”

Bronze
Table of Contents Design

Denine D’Angelo, art director

“This is a Table of Contents page that knows how to play the big stories well while still giving some prominence to the regular features. The publication also gives the chance for a young artist to shine by highlighting a watercolor painting on the page.”
 
In addition, the Virginia Press Association awarded Richmond Parents Monthly a first-place prize in Critical Writing for the “RPM KidSpin” column by Joe Cates. The VPA’s contest for work published in 2007 drew more than 5,000 entries from newspapers and magazines across the state.
